An efficient aldol-based approach for the synthesis of dihydrokawain-5-ol
چکیده انگلیسی

An efficient and simple aldol-based convergent approach toward the total synthesis of (+)- and (−)-dihydrokawain-5-ol is described. The key features of this synthetic strategy include Evans’ aldol reaction and an ethyl acetate addition reaction for the formation of the six-membered ring.

(4S)-4-Benzyl-3-[(2S,3R)-2-(benzyloxy)-3-hydroxy-5-phenylpentanoyl]-1,3-oxazolan-2-oneC28H29NO5[α]D25=+70.5 (c 1.5, CHCl3)Source of chirality: Evans’ asymmetric aldolAbsolute configuration:(2S,3R)

(2S,3R)-2-(Benzyloxy)-3-hydroxy-N-methoxy-N-methyl-5-phenylpentanamideC20H25NO4[α]D25=-13.5 (c 1.1, CHCl3)Source of chirality: Evans’ asymmetric aldolAbsolute configuration:(2S,3R)

(2S,3R)-2-(Benzyloxy)-3-(tert-butyldimethylsilyloxy)-N-methoxy-N-methyl-5-phenylpentanamideC26H39NO4Si[α]D25=-4.4 (c 1.4, CHCl3)Source of chirality: Evans’ asymmetric aldolAbsolute configuration: (2S,3R)

Ethyl(4R,5R)-4-(benzyloxy)-5-[1-(tert-butyl)-1,1-dimethylsilyl]oxy-3-hydroxy-7-phenylheptanoateC28H42O5Si[α]D25=+33.4 (c 1.1, CHCl3)Source of chirality: Evans’ asymmetric aldolAbsolute configuration: (4R,5R)

Ethyl(4S,5R)-4-(benzyloxy)-5-[1-(tert-butyl)-1,1-dimethylsilyl]oxy-3-oxo-7-phenylheptanoateC28H40O5Si[α]D25=+6.8 (c 1.1, CHCl3)Source of chirality: Evans’ asymmetric aldolAbsolute configuration: (4S,5R)

(5S,6R)-5-(Benzyloxy)-4-methoxy-6-phenethyl-5,6-dihydro-2H-2-pyranoneC21H22O4[α]D25=-118.9 (c 1.5, CHCl3)Source of chirality: Evans’ asymmetric aldolAbsolute configuration: (5S,6R)

(5S,6R)-5-Hydroxy-4-methoxy-6-phenethyl-5,6-dihydro-2H-2-pyranoneC14H16O4[α]D25=-63.2 (c 1.1, CHCl3)Source of chirality: Evans’ asymmetric aldolAbsolute configuration: (5S,6R)
